Chris Pratt and Charlie Day, who voice the famous video game siblings Mario and Luigi respectively, in the upcoming animated movie, “The Super Mario Bros. Movie”, reveal in an interview with Yahoo Entertainment that their kids have differing preferences when it comes to the Nintendo characters they play.
Pratt shares that his 10-year-old son, Jack, favors Luigi over Mario in the video game, Super Smash Bros. Ultimate. To Pratt’s surprise, Jack’s second favorite character is Toad, the Mushroom Kingdom friend of the famous plumbers, voiced by Keegan-Michael Key in the film. According to Pratt, Jack has even pointed out the fact that Toad has teeth in the movie, which he finds interesting.
